In a rapidly changing society at the dawn of the 20th century, "The Indifference of Juliet" by Grace S. Richmond explores the intricate dynamics of love and social class. Juliet Marcy, caught between her affections for the impoverished yet noble Anthony Robeson and the expectations of her own privileged background, grapples with the weight of societal norms and personal desires. This novel delves into themes of emotional conflict and the stark realities of class disparity, showcasing Richmond's keen insight into human relationships.
